Abstract :
The paper presents the stability analysis of axially loaded, thin-walled open section, orthotropic composite columns. Vlasovʹs classical theory is modified to include both the transverse (flexural) shear and the restrained warping induced shear deformations. In addition to the bending stiffness matrix a (3×3) shear stiffness matrix is introduced. A closed form solution is derived for the flexural–torsional buckling load of composite columns. A simplified, approximate solution is also presented, in which the effect of the shear deformations is included using Föpplʹs theorem.
